Randy Oxentenko wrote: > Another gentelman named Mike Brown supplied a pointer to another technique > that involves the use of extension functions, which are part of exslt. This > technique would use features of XSLT that go beyond the defined standard. IIRC, Dimitre's solution relies on an extension function, too: exsl:node-set() or the vendor-specific equivalent. There are no pure XSLT 1.0 solutions. I'd be curious to know how the two solutions compare, time-wise, in whatever XSLT processor you are using. -Mike XSL-List info and archive: http://www.mulberrytech.com/xsl/xsl-list
